Bringing back the TF discussion:

http://v.youku.com/v_show/id_XNDI4MjQwNTg4.html

This is how to play TF.



This looks like an awesome guide/informative video I just wish I understood his rune and mastery explanations. Could you enlighten?

Summary of Runes/Masteries section:

MPen marks, HP@18 seals, AP@18 glyphs, AP quints - uses the scaling HP/AP glyphs for stronger midgame, less laning-focused runepage
MPen marks, Flat Mp5 OR Mp5@18 seals, AP@18 glyphs OR flat MR glyphs, MS quints - Runepage focused more toward ganking power. The MR glyphs can be leveraged against stronger enemy AP laners, and the MS is critical in ganking.

21/0/9 - Aimed to maximize burst damage on ganks in the level 6-10 range, sacrifices movespeed, and other gains from Utility tree
9/0/21 - Picks up later tier utility talents at the cost of damage. Smoother to use in cases where you don't get as much damage.

Dear TeamLiquid,

I have been playing League of Legends for quite a while now and I am currently stuck somewhere between 1200 and 1400 elo. I feel like I have very little influence on the outcome of a game at all since at this elo, it all seems to depend on whoever has the least retarded team. I am by no means saying I am always playing the perfect game and that I never make any mistakes, but 95% of the games lost are caused by one or more people that apparantly still haven't mastered the basics of the game even after 30 levels of play and 200-ish ranked wins. I mostly play jungle, and occasionally top and i find it extremely difficult to carry as a jungler at this elo. It doesn't really matter if you give your carry 8 kills when he feels he has to walk into an unwarded enemy jungle over and over in the lategame. On the other hand, most of my wins are 'won' because of the enemy teams incompetence as well. It is very rare that you actually get to play a good, close and statisfying game of league of legends at this elo in solo queue.

Some prime examples of what I run into every day:

- People counterpicking themselves 'I have never lost a lane against champion X!' - Proceeds to get stomped
- AD/AP Carries facechecking brushes instead of letting the tankier champions do so - Usually results in insta-death and a lost teamfight and/or baron
- No gp10 supports that fall off hard mid-late game
- People with 40 cs after 15 minutes who have not died at all, have not ganked other lanes and didnt even back once (how is this even possible?)
- People complaining that they lost their lane and couldn't farm because they dont get any ganks when they themselves have not been ganked and are supposed to have counterpicked their opponent.
- People not paying attention when ganks are coming, even when warned with a ping and a chat message
- People going afk because they feel insulted when someone kindly asks them to change their summoners/build with proper argumentation 'DONT TELL ME HOW TO PLAY NOOB' 'All: My team flame so I afk'

I feel like I do not belong in this elo at all and this is somewhat proved when I duo with friends in the 16-1700's. I usually do a great job jungling there since the people actually pay attention and I win my lanes most of the time as well. The games there are just so much more fun and losses can be accepted more easily because the games are usually close. I am not saying that trolling or people failing over and over does not happen here, but its waaaay less then the elo i am currently at.

What would you guys recommend me to do to reach a higher ELO? I am currently pondering to create a smurf, buy exp and ip boosts and to duo queue once I reach 30. Would this be worth it and have reasonable odds of succes?Or should I just give up on jungling for now and just queue as another role that can carry a game on its own more easily?

Junglers can carry easily if they are supposed to be at a way higher elo. If you know how to carry as a jungler, that is.
You have to identify what kind of playstyle works for you at your elo, also depending on the other picks.
Typically, if you actually are better than everyone else in the game, you might want to press that advantage early through ganks or killing the enemy jungler by predicting when and where he will be vulnerable, potentially telling an ally to push and assist.

If you can't do it, you're where you should be. Solo queue is not just a matter of mechanical skill, it's also about correctly juding the situation and directing your allies without causing a flame war.

While there are, and always will be some games that are straight up unwinnable, for the most part, games should be equal footing or in your favor. In statistical terms, your team has 4 chances to get an utter dunce, while the other team has 5 chances to get a complete tard; assuming, of course, that you truly do belong at a higher elo.

Now, getting to the “how to win games” portion. The easiest roles to play to win games is jungler or mid imo. Those two roles have the biggest impact in the game since they dictate the flow of the game. As jungler, keep an eye out for ways to help your team get ahead. Also look for opportunities to fuck over the other jungler. Steal buffs, sneak dragons, all that stuff. If you’re truly higher elo, and you’re doing it right, you will get your team a lead. All you have to do then is to keep that lead and secure the victory. That’s the hard part.

Be a genuinely good person. It’s easier to get people to listen when you’re not condescending or flaming them. It also helps if you’re doing well; people tend to listen to someone with a 16/0/25 score than someone who’s going 0/27/0. Make sure you’re always communicating with your team. Tell them to back the fuck off, gtfo lanes, and basically lead your team. Be stern but not insulting. Mass ping, use caps lock do w/e it takes, just don’t piss them off.

Best way to keep your team from losing stupidly? WARDS, WARDS, AND MORE WARDS. Especially at low elo, people tend to not ward. If you notice your support isn’t warding, then you do it. Suck it up and buy 1~2 wards every time you back if you have a free slot. A ward is basically 2~3 creep; it’s not much. If you feel up to it, get an oracles. Map vision and generally having more information than the other team is the #2 underrated key to victory, second only to last hitting.
